Color Mania #4: Brown
Did you know?

Did you know?
- Brown is a color, denoting a range of composite colors produced by a mixture of orange, red, rose, or yellow with black or gray.
- Brown represents wholesomeness and earthiness.
- The Dravidian Caucasoids and Indo-Aryan people of South Asia are sometimes called brown.
- The Japanese do not have a specific word for brown. Rather, they use more descriptive names such as “tea-color," "fox-color," and "fallen-leaf.”
- In the United States, Thanksgiving is represented by brown and orange.
- If you dream of the color brown, it means you will be lucky with money.

Ingredients:
Hot milk - 1 cup
Instant coffee powder - 3 tsp
Chocolate syrup - 2 tblsp
Sugar - for taste (If your chocolate syrup is unsweetened and if you have a sweet tooth)
Whipped Cream - optional

Method:
Stir in hot milk, instant coffee powder and sugar in a pan. Switch off the flame and add the chocolate syrup to it and mix well. Top it with whipped cream and serve hot. :)
The instant coffee powder used matters a lot. I used Melosa 3 in 1 instant cappuccino powder to make my cup of delicious coffee. :) Since Melosa has added sugar and creamer in it, my chocolaty coffee was thick and creamy :)

Note: You can serve it cold too. Its yummy both ways.
You can also add steamed milk foam or whipped cream as a topping. :)
If you don't have chocolate syrup, either double boil a small bar of chocolate or mix in two tsp of cocoa powder with 3 tsp of water and boil it along with some sugar and add it to the coffee.
